WHAT YOU WILL BE ABLE TO DO

The skills you will have by the end of this course.

  • Define and calculate SLIs, SLOs, SLAs, and error budgets for production services
  • Build and interpret observability stacks using Prometheus, Grafana, logs, and traces
  • Design effective alerting strategies and manage the full incident lifecycle
  • Apply Kubernetes reliability patterns including probes, autoscaling, PDBs, and deployment strategies
  • Implement GitOps-based, safe software delivery with rollback and progressive delivery techniques
  • Plan disaster recovery strategies and execute chaos engineering and load testing exercises
  • Lead root cause analysis and produce blameless postmortems and runbooks
  • Leverage AI-assisted tools for troubleshooting, RCA, and incident response
CONDENSED SYLLABUS

See the structure without reading a textbook.

Modules stay collapsed for quick scanning. Open any module to inspect its topics.

01Introduction to Site Reliability Engineering6 lessons+

What is SRE? Evolution from Operations to DevOps to SRE

DevOps vs SRE and Reliability Engineering Principles

Production Mindset and Service Lifecycle

Shared Responsibility Model, Toil, and Automation

SRE Roles and Responsibilities

Lab: Calculate Availability and Identify Toil

02Measuring Service Reliability6 lessons+

Why Reliability Needs Metrics: Availability vs Reliability

Service Level Indicators (SLI) and Objectives (SLO)

Service Level Agreements (SLA) and Error Budgets

MTTD, MTTR, and MTBF

DORA Metrics for Delivery Performance

Lab: Define SLOs and Calculate Error Budgets

03Monitoring & Observability6 lessons+

Monitoring vs Observability and the Three Pillars

Metrics, Logs, and Traces Fundamentals

Golden Signals, RED Method, and USE Method

Metrics Collection with Prometheus

Visualizing System Health with Grafana and Distributed Tracing

Lab: Analyze Dashboards and Detect Bottlenecks

04Alerting & Incident Management6 lessons+

Alerting Principles and Prometheus Alertmanager

Alert Fatigue, Severity, and Prioritization

Incident Lifecycle and Response Process

On-call Best Practices and Blameless Postmortems

Root Cause Analysis and Writing Effective Runbooks

Lab: Simulate Incidents, Perform RCA, and Write a Postmortem

05Kubernetes Reliability Engineering6 lessons+

Self-Healing, Liveness, Readiness, and Startup Probes

Resource Requests, Limits, and Horizontal/Vertical Autoscaling

Pod Disruption Budgets and Scheduling for Reliability

Node Affinity, Anti-Affinity, and Topology Spread Constraints

Reliable Deployment Strategies: Rolling, Blue-Green, Canary

Lab: Troubleshoot Pods, Simulate Node Failure, and Test HPA

06Reliable Software Delivery6 lessons+

CI/CD Reliability and GitOps Principles

Progressive Delivery and Safe Deployment Practices

Rollback vs Roll-forward and Release Management

Configuration and Secret Management

Change Management, Deployment Verification, and Supply Chain Security

Lab: GitOps Sync and Safe Production Release Simulation

07Production Resilience & Disaster Recovery6 lessons+

Disaster Recovery Fundamentals and High Availability Architecture

Backup & Restore, RTO, and RPO

Single Point of Failure and Capacity Planning Review

Load Testing Concepts and Chaos Engineering

Recovery Strategies: Active-Active, Active-Passive, Warm Standby, Pilot Light

Lab: Restore from Backup and Run Chaos Testing Scenarios

08Modern SRE Operations & Production Scenarios6 lessons+

End-to-End Troubleshooting Methodology

Common Production Failures and Case Studies

Cost vs Reliability Trade-offs

AI for SRE: AIOps, AI-assisted Troubleshooting and RCA

SRE Career Roadmap and Continuous Improvement

Capstone Lab: Full Production Incident Simulation
